I've almost finished the first front roll and now need to neaten up the rubber tyre, what has everyone used to do this? I tried a flap wheel but nothing really seemed to happen!

I trimmed mine up a bit with a scalpel,just to tidy it up,was a bit wary of using a powered disc as i didn't want the rubber delaminating.
Hopefully it will "rub in" as it gets some use.

I have used 40 and 60 grit flap wheels to "adjust" the rubber on wheels before it just takes a bit of time
